    Why Communication Matters for Safety

    • Enables early identification and reporting of hazards such as fire risks, flooding, and unsafe structures
    • Builds trust and cooperation necessary for successful safety interventions and compliance
    • Helps governments design policies and programs that reflect the real needs and priorities of residents
    • Empowers communities with information about their rights, safety standards, and available resources

    Challenges in Government-Community Communication

    • Language barriers and low literacy levels in informal settlements
    • Lack of trust due to past neglect, broken promises, or forced evictions
    • Inadequate channels for two-way communication; information often flows one way only
    • Limited government capacity or willingness to engage meaningfully with informal settlers

    Introduction

    Informal settlements face numerous safety challenges due to inadequate infrastructure, hazardous locations, and limited access to essential services. Local governments play a pivotal role in ensuring safety compliance by regulating land use, providing services, and enforcing standards tailored to the unique context of informal settlements.

    At Neftaly, we highlight how proactive local government engagement is critical to building safer, more resilient informal communities.


    Why Local Government Matters

    • Policy and Regulation: Local authorities set safety standards for housing, sanitation, drainage, and environmental management.
    • Service Delivery: They are responsible for providing or facilitating access to clean water, waste management, electricity, and emergency services.
    • Enforcement: Ensuring compliance with safety regulations reduces risks from fire, flooding, structural collapse, and pollution.
    • Coordination: Local government coordinates with other agencies, NGOs, and communities to implement safety initiatives.

    Key Roles of Local Government in Safety Compliance

    1. Developing Inclusive Safety Policies

    • Creating frameworks that recognize informal settlements and their needs
    • Integrating safety compliance into broader urban development plans

    2. Facilitating Access to Basic Services

    • Expanding infrastructure for water, sanitation, and electricity
    • Supporting waste collection and management systems

    3. Monitoring and Inspection

    • Conducting regular assessments of housing and infrastructure safety
    • Identifying and addressing hazardous conditions such as blocked drainage or unsafe construction

    4. Community Engagement and Capacity Building

    • Working with residents to raise awareness of safety practices
    • Supporting community-led monitoring and reporting mechanisms

    Challenges and Opportunities

    • Challenges: Limited resources, unclear land tenure, and rapid settlement growth can hinder enforcement efforts.
    • Opportunities: Partnerships with communities and NGOs can improve compliance and build trust.

    Key Government Responsibilities in Safety Compliance

    ????️ Policy Development and Legal Frameworks

    • Establish laws and policies that recognize informal settlements and set minimum safety standards.
    • Ensure regulations accommodate the unique challenges of informal housing and infrastructure.
    • Promote frameworks that balance enforcement with residents’ rights and socio-economic realities.

    ???? Inspection, Monitoring, and Enforcement

    • Conduct regular safety inspections to identify risks related to electrical wiring, building materials, energy use, and fire hazards.
    • Enforce safety codes fairly and consistently, avoiding punitive measures that may exacerbate vulnerability.
    • Support community-led monitoring initiatives to increase coverage and trust.

    ????️ Infrastructure Development and Upgrading

    • Invest in safe and sustainable infrastructure, including water supply, sanitation, electricity, and roads.
    • Facilitate formal electrification and safe energy access, reducing reliance on dangerous makeshift connections.
    • Promote firebreaks, adequate spacing, and other physical safety improvements within settlements.

    ????‍????‍???? Community Engagement and Capacity Building

    • Involve residents in safety planning and decision-making processes.
    • Support training programs for local electricians, builders, and safety volunteers.
    • Facilitate awareness campaigns on fire prevention, safe wiring, and energy use.
